Behzod Abduraimov, an Uzbekistani classical pianist renowned for his powerful technique and emotionally resonant interpretations, will perform in Zaragoza, Spain on November 16, 2026. His repertoire spans a broad range, though he is particularly celebrated for his performances of Romantic-era composers like Rachmaninoff and Chopin, alongside works by Prokofiev – reflecting his own heritage – and standard classical masters. Abduraimov’s playing is often described as possessing both virtuosic brilliance and lyrical depth. He gained international recognition after winning the International Piano Competition in Boston in 2010.

Zaragoza, the capital city of Aragon in northeastern Spain, has a rich history dating back to Roman times, originally founded as *Caesaraugusta* by Augustus in 24 BC. Throughout its history, it has been a significant crossroads of cultures – Roman, Moorish, and Christian influences are all visible in its architecture. The Basilica del Pilar, a prominent baroque landmark dedicated to the Virgin Mary, is central to the city's identity and a major pilgrimage site. Zaragoza’s cultural scene also encompasses a thriving contemporary arts community alongside preservation of its historical legacy.
